Open Poetry #44

No longer strong,
silently screaming.
Needing
something more than this.
Yet, no one notices
anything amiss.

That thing that happened,
the thing that cut me in half,
it haunts me now
hurting every time I think
I might have a life back.

I don’t weep so much for that
as much as for the difference
in me.
Ruined, a façade of what used to be.

What no one seems to understand
is that it isn’t so much you that I lost
or never had,
but rather, all hope
of feeling like that again.
